Description

The Chord Electronics Choral Ensemble Stand is a purpose-built equipment rack designed to house and display the Choral range components. It holds up to four Choral units (any combination of DAVE, Prima, Etude, and Symphonic) in a single, stable structure that matches the aesthetic of the components themselves.

Key Features
  • Accommodates up to four Choral-range components
  • Integrated cable management to keep connections tidy
  • Matched finish to complement the Choral product line
  • Ventilation spacing between shelves for proper heat dissipation
  • Stable, rigid construction to minimize vibration transfer between components
Why We Carry Chord Electronics

Chord Electronics has been doing digital conversion differently since 1989. While every other manufacturer buys off-the-shelf DAC chips, Rob Watts designs custom FPGA algorithms with tap lengths that dwarf anything from ESS or AKM. Their proprietary Pulse Array technology, MOSFET amplification stages, and high-frequency switch-mode power supplies are all designed and built in Kent, England. From the portable Mojo 2 to the flagship DAVE, every product runs code that Chord wrote themselves.

System Integration

The Ensemble Stand is designed around the specific dimensions of Choral components. Each shelf is spaced to allow adequate ventilation (the Etude in particular generates heat under load) while keeping the overall footprint compact. Cables route through the back of the stand, keeping the front presentation clean. The structure holds the weight of a full four-unit stack without flexing, and the base provides stable footing on any surface.

The Choral Range

A typical full Choral system on the Ensemble Stand might include the DAVE as DAC/preamp, the Etude for speaker amplification, the Symphonic for vinyl, and the Prima for source switching. Available in black, silver, or natural finish.
